Output 23c500a5b775a6551e5015cf7329be9a14ec88709302b1ecbde42675efa51937:8

value
102634
script pubkey
OP_0 OP_PUSHBYTES_20 dca39037ecb9a8a7ca6d38b83dc25b7a07590832
address
bc1qmj3eqdlvhx520jnd8zurmsjm0gr4jzpjlrpkjf
transaction
23c500a5b775a6551e5015cf7329be9a14ec88709302b1ecbde42675efa51937